×

跨组织工作流的合同作为时间动态条件响应图。 (英语) Zbl 1283.68245号

摘要:我们保守地扩展了第二作者在博士论文中介绍的声明性动态条件响应(DCR)图过程模型,以考虑离散的时间期限。我们证明了将有限时间DCR图映射到有限状态转移系统可以验证安全性和活性。我们举例说明了截止日期是如何引入时间锁和死锁并破坏活跃性的。然后,我们证明了先前工作中提供的DCR图安全分布的一般技术可以扩展到定时DCR图。我们举例说明了时间DCR图和分布技术在实践中的使用,这是由先前的案例研究中产生的跨组织案例管理过程的时间扩展。该示例显示了如何使用定时DCR图来描述涉及多个组织的定时工作流过程的全局契约,然后可以将其作为描述每个组织的本地契约的通信定时DCR图形网络进行分发。

MSC公司:

68问题85 并发和分布式计算的模型和方法(进程代数、互模拟、转换网等)
90B70型 组织理论,运筹学中的人力规划

软件:

自旋蛋白
PDF格式BibTeX公司 XML格式引用
全文: 内政部

参考文献:

[1] v.d.Aalst,W.M.P。;Weske,M.,《组织间工作流的p2p方法》(《第13届先进信息系统工程国际会议论文集》,第13届高级信息系统工程会议论文集,CAiSE’01(2001)),140-156·Zbl 0980.68857号
[2] 阿鲁尔(Alur,R.)。;Dill,D.,《实时系统建模的自动化》,(Paterson,M.,《自动化》,《语言与编程》。《自动化》、《语言与程序》,《计算机科学讲义》,第443卷(1990年),Springer:Springer Berlin,Heidelberg),322-335·Zbl 0765.68150号
[3] Bellini,P。;马托里尼,R。;Nesi,P.,实时系统规范的时序逻辑,ACM计算调查,32,12-42(2000)
[4] Berthomieu,B。;Diaz,M.,《使用时间Petri网对依赖时间的系统进行建模和验证》,IEEE软件工程学报,17,259-273(1991)
[5] 布拉维蒂,M。;Zavattaro,G.,基于合同的多方服务组合,(软件工程基础国际研讨会,第4767卷(2007年),Springer),207-222·Zbl 1141.68502号
[6] 布拉维蒂,M。;Zavattaro,G.,《强服务遵从性契约理论》,计算机科学中的MSCS数学结构,第19期,第601-638页(2009年)·Zbl 1186.68318号
[7] Burns,J.C.,《办公室信息系统的演变,数据化》,23,4,60-64(1977)
[8] Carbone,M。;本田,K。;Yoshida,N.,《以结构化通信为中心的网络服务编程》,(第16届欧洲编程研讨会(ESOP’07)。第16届欧洲程序设计研讨会(ESOP?07),LNCS(2007),Springer,2-17·Zbl 1187.68064号
[9] 卡塞兹,F。;Roux,O.H.,《从时间Petri网到时间自动机的结构转换》,《理论计算机科学电子笔记》,128145-160(2005)·Zbl 1272.68294号
[10] 卡斯特拉尼,I。;Mukund,M。;Thiagarajan,P.,从全球规范合成分布式过渡系统,(软件技术和理论计算机科学基础,第1738卷(1999年),施普林格:施普林格柏林,海德堡),219-231·Zbl 0956.68008号
[11] 克拉克,E.M。;格伦伯格,O。;Peled,D.A.,《模型检验》(1999),麻省理工学院出版社
[12] Dong,G。;赫尔,R。;库马尔,B。;苏,J。;Zhou,G.,优化分布式工作流执行的框架,(第七届数据库程序设计语言国际研讨会修订论文:结构化和半结构化数据库程序设计的研究问题。第七届数据库程序设计语言国际研讨会修订论文:结构化和半结构化数据库程序设计的研究问题,DBPL \ 99(2000),斯普林格·弗拉格:英国伦敦斯普林格尔·弗拉格),152-167·Zbl 1044.68513号
[13] 杜马,M。;范德阿尔斯特,W.M。;ter Hofstede,A.H.,《过程感知信息系统:通过过程技术架起人与软件的桥梁》(2005),Wiley-Interscience
[14] 德怀尔,M。;Avrunin,G。;Corbett,J.,有限状态验证的属性规范模式,(1999年软件工程国际会议论文集(1999)),411-420
[15] Ellis,C.A.,《信息控制网:办公室信息流的数学模型》,(计算机系统的仿真、测量和建模会议论文集。计算机系统的模拟、测量和模型会议论文集,ACM SIGMETRICS性能评估评论,第8卷(1979)),225-240
[16] 埃利斯,C.A。;Nutt,G.J.,办公信息系统和计算机科学,ACM计算调查,12,27-60(1980)
[17] Eshuis,H.,《用于工作流建模的UML活动图的语义和验证》(2002),特温特大学,CTIT博士,论文系列02-44
[18] 埃斯胡伊斯,R。;Wieringa,R.,《验证uml活动图的工具支持》,IEEE软件工程学报,30437-447(2004)
[19] Fahland,D.,《分析声明性工作流》,(Koehler,J.;Pistore,M.;Sheth,A.P.;Traverso,P.;Wirsing,M.,《自治和自适应Web服务》,《自治与自适应Web服务,Dagstuhl研讨会论文集》,第07061卷(2007年),国际Begegnungs-und Forschungszentrum fuer Informatik(IBFI),达格斯图尔宫:国际Begegnungs-und Forschungszentrum fuer Informatik(IBFI),德国达格斯图宫
[20] 西弗迪拉。;Godart,C.,复合web服务分散编排之间的同步,(CollaborateCom’09(2009)),1-10
[21] 西弗迪拉。;尤里迪斯。;Godart,C.,《使用依赖表实现自动流程分散的灵活方法》(Web服务国际会议(2009))
[22] Fu,X。;布尔坦,T。;Su,J.,具有消息内容的会话协议的可实现性,(IEEE Web服务国际会议论文集。IEEE Web Services国际会议论文集中,ICWS?04(2004),IEEE计算机学会:IEEE计算机协会,华盛顿特区,美国),96
[23] Hanisch,H.-M.,《带时间弧的位置/转移网络分析及其在批处理过程控制中的应用》,(Ajmone Marsan,M.,《Petri网的应用与理论》,1993年。Petri网的应用和理论1993,计算机科学讲义,第691卷(1993),施普林格:施普林格柏林,海德堡),282-299
[24] Heljanko,K。;Stefanescu,A.,检查分布式可实现性的复杂性结果,(第五届并行应用于系统设计国际会议论文集。第五届并发应用于系统开发国际会议论文录,ACSD’05(2005),IEEE计算机学会:IEEE计算机协会,华盛顿,DC),78-87
[25] Hildebrandt,T.,《值得信赖的普及医疗流程(TrustCare)研究项目》(2008年),网页
[26] Hildebrandt,T.,《动态条件响应图——基于事件过程的动态时序逻辑》(第八届斯堪的纳维亚逻辑研讨会(2012年8月20日至21日),第52-54页
[27] 希尔德布兰特,T.T。;Mukkamala,R.R.,作为分布式动态条件响应图的基于事件的声明性工作流,(Honda,K.;Mycroft,A.,PLACES.PLACES,EPTCS,第69卷(2011)),59-73
[28] 希尔德布兰特,T。;R.R.穆卡拉。;Slaats,T.,声明性过程的安全分配,(第九届软件工程和形式方法国际会议论文集。第九届国际软件工程与形式方法会议论文集,SEFM?11(2011),Springer-Verlag:Springer-Verlag Berlin,Heidelberg),237-252
[29] 希尔德布兰特,T。;穆卡马拉,R。;Slaats,T.,使用动态条件响应图设计跨组织案例管理系统,(第15届IEEE企业分布式对象计算国际会议(EDOC)(2011)),161-170
[30] 希尔德布兰特,T。;R.R.穆卡拉。;Slaats,T.,嵌套动态条件响应图,(软件工程基础学报(FSEN))。软件工程基础学报(FSEN),LNCS,第7141卷(2012),Springer-Verlag),343-350·Zbl 1353.68205号
[32] 希尔德布兰特,T。;R.R.穆卡拉。;斯莱茨,T。;Zanitti,F.,《具有动态条件响应图的模块化上下文敏感和面向方面过程》(面向方面语言基础(2013))
[33] 希尔德布兰特,T。;Zanitti,F.,一种面向过程的基于事件的编程语言,(Bry,F.;Paschke,A.;Eugster,P.T.;Fetzer,C.;Behrend,A.,DEBS(2012),ACM),377-378
[34] Holzmann,G.J.,模型检查器旋转,IEEE软件工程汇刊,23279-295(1997)
[35] 哈拉夫,R。;Leymann,F.,使用BPEL进行基于角色的业务流程分解,(Web服务国际会议,Web服务国际大会,ICWS’06(2006)),770-780
[36] Kindler,E。;Martens,A。;Reisig,W.,工作流应用程序的互操作性:全球稳健性的本地标准,(业务流程管理、模型、技术和实证研究(2000),Springer-Verlag:Springer-Verlag London,UK),235-253
[37] K.J.克里斯托弗森。;佩德森,C。;Andersen,H.R.,使用析取归一化方程系统对定时ltl进行运行时验证,《理论计算机科学电子笔记》,89,210-225(2003)
[38] Ling,S。;Schmidt,H.,工作流建模和分析的时间Petri网,(IEEE系统、人与控制论国际会议,第4卷(2000)),3039-3044
[39] Maria Maggi,F。;蒙塔利,M。;Westergaard,M。;van der Aalst,W.M.P.,《用线性时序逻辑监控业务约束:基于彩色自动机的方法》(business Process Management,BPM)。业务流程管理(BPM),计算机科学讲义,第6896卷(2011)),32-147
[40] Martens,A.,《分析基于web服务的业务流程》(第八届国际会议论文集,作为软件工程基本方法欧洲软件理论与实践联合会议的一部分举行)。第八届国际会议记录,作为软件工程基本方法欧洲软件理论与实践联合会议的一部分,FASE’05(2005),Springer-Verlag:Springer-Verlag Berlin,Heidelberg),19-33·Zbl 1119.68305号
[41] Merlin,P.M.,《计算系统可恢复性研究》(1974年),加利福尼亚大学:加利福尼亚大学欧文分校,AAI7511026
[42] Milosevic,Z。;Sadiq,S。;Orlowska,M.,走向一种推导符合合同的业务流程的方法,(业务流程管理。业务流程管理,计算机科学讲义,第4102卷(2006年),施普林格:施普林格柏林,海德堡),395-400
[43] 密特拉,S。;库马尔,R。;Basu,S.,《web服务组合的最佳分散编排》(2008年IEEE服务计算国际会议论文集,第2卷(2008)),395-402
[44] Montali,M.,《声明性开放交互模型的规范和验证:基于逻辑的方法》,《商业信息处理课堂讲稿》,第56卷(2010年),Springer·兹比尔1252.68021
[45] Mukkamala,R.R.,声明性工作流的形式化模型-动态条件响应图(2012),哥本哈根IT大学,ITU DS D-2012-80
[46] 穆卡马拉,R。;Hildebrandt,T.,《从动态条件响应结构到Büchi自动机》,(第四届IEEE软件工程理论方面国际研讨会(TASE)(2010)),187-190
[47] R.R.穆卡拉。;希尔德布兰特,T。;Töth,J.B.,The resultmaker online consultant:From declarative workflow management in practice to ltl,(2008年第12届企业分布式对象计算会议研讨会论文集,IEEE计算机学会:IEEE计算机协会(美国华盛顿特区),135-142
[48] Mukund,M.,《从全球规范到分布式实现》,(离散事件系统的合成与控制(2002),Springer),19-35·Zbl 1054.93037号
[49] Nanda,M.G。;Chandra,S。;Sarkar,V.,复合web服务的分散执行,SIGPLAN通知,39,170-187(2004)
[51] 对象管理组BPMN技术委员会,业务流程模型和符号,2.0版,网页,2011年
[52] Papazoglou,M.,使业务流程符合标准和法规,(企业分布式对象计算会议(EDOC),第15届IEEE国际(2011)),3-13
[53] 佩西奇,M。;Schonenberg,M.H。;Sidorova,N。;Van Der Aalst,W.M.P.,《基于约束的工作流模型:改变变得容易》,(2007年OTM联合会关于转向有意义互联网系统的国际会议论文集:CoopIS、DOA、ODBASE、GADA和IS——第一卷)。2007年OTM联合会关于转向有意义互联网系统的国际会议记录:CoopIS、DOA、ODBASE、GADA和IS——第一卷,OTM’07(2007),Springer-Verlag:Springer-Verlag Berlin,Heidelberg),77-94
[54] 佩西奇,M。;van der Aalst,W.M.P.,《灵活业务流程管理的声明性方法》,(2006年国际业务流程管理研讨会论文集。2006年国际商业流程管理研讨会文献集,BPM’06(2006),Springer-Verlag:Springer-Verlag Berlin,Heidelberg), 169-180
[55] Petri,C.A.,Kommunikation mit Automaten(1962),汉堡大学博士论文
[57] Popova-Zeugmann,L.,On-time Petri nets,Elektronische Informations verarbeitung und Kybernetik,27,227-244(1991)·Zbl 0731.68082号
[58] 波波瓦·齐格曼,L。;Schlater,D.,《分析时间Petri网中的路径》,《信息学基础》,37311-327(1999)·Zbl 0930.68098号
[59] Ramchandani,C.,《用定时Petri网分析异步并发系统》(1974),麻省理工学院:麻省理工科学院,美国马萨诸塞州剑桥,博士论文
[60] Resultmaker(2008)
[61] Rinderle,S。;Wombacher,A。;Reichert,M.,《流程编排在dychor中的演变》,(《走向有意义的互联网系统2006:CoopIS、DOA、GADA和ODBASE》,《走向有含义的互联网系统2006:CoopIS,DOA、GA和ODBACE》,LNCS,第4275卷(2006),斯普林格出版社),273-290
[62] Sadiq,W。;Sadiq,S。;Schulz,K.,协作业务流程的模型驱动分布,(IEEE国际服务计算会议,IEEE国际服务计算会议,SCC’06(2006)),281-284
[63] ter Hofstede,A。;范·格拉贝克,R。;Stork,D.,《查询网:确保全局终止的交互工作流模块》(Business Process Management(2003),施普林格:施普林格-柏林,海德堡),184-199
[64] van der Aalst,W.M.P.,《组织间工作流:基于消息序列图和Petri网的方法》,系统分析、建模、仿真,34,335-367(1999)·Zbl 0958.68541号
[65] van der Aalst,W.,《组织间工作流的继承:如何在不失去控制的情况下同意不同意见?》?,信息技术与管理,4345-389(2003)
[66] 范德阿尔斯特,W.M.P。;北卡罗来纳州洛曼。;马苏斯,P。;斯塔尔,C。;Wolf,K.,《多方合同:同意和实施组织间流程》,《计算机杂志》,第53期,第90-106页(2010年)
[67] 范德阿尔斯特,W.M。;Pesic,M.,DecSerFlow:走向一种真正的声明性服务流语言(Bravetti,M.;Nunez,M.);Zavataro,G.,《Web服务和形式化方法学报》(WS-FM 2006)。《Web服务和形式方法学报》(WS-FM 2006),LNCS,第4184卷(2006),Springer-Verlag),1-23
[68] 范德拉尔斯特,W。;韦斯克,M。;Grunbauer,D.,《案例处理:业务流程支持的新范式》,数据与知识工程,53,129-162(2005)
[69] Vardi,M.Y.,线性时序逻辑的自动机理论方法,(并发逻辑:结构与自动机。并发逻辑:结构化与自动机,计算机科学讲义,第1043卷(1996),Springer-Verlag),238-266
[70] Walter,B.,《建模和分析具有实时特性的协议的定时Petri网》(协议规范、测试和验证III(1983),Elsevier Science Publ。B.V.(北荷兰),149-159
[71] 沃特克,D。;Weikum,G.,基于状态图的分布式工作流执行的正式基础,(第六届数据库理论国际会议论文集(1997),Springer-Verlag:Springer-Verlag London,UK),230-246
[72] Yi,X。;Kochut,K.,《使用复杂会话协议的web服务过程组合:基于有色Petri网的方法》,(2004年高级仿真技术分布式系统设计、分析和仿真研讨会),141-148
[73] Zielonka,W.,有限异步自动机注释,Informatique Théorique et Applications,21,2,99-135(1987)·Zbl 0623.68055号
[74] 齐斯曼,M.D.,办公程序的表示、规范和自动化(1977),宾夕法尼亚大学沃顿学院,博士论文
[75] Zuberek,W.M.,《时间Petri网和初步性能评估》,(第七届计算机体系结构年度研讨会论文集。第七届年度计算机体系结构研讨会论文集,ISCA?80(1980),ACM:美国纽约州纽约市ACM),88-96
此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。